Neighborhood Overview

Situated in the southwestern part of West Palm Beach, the Junior Academy is part of a growing community with a blend of residential areas and recreational facilities. The primary access route is Summit Boulevard, which connects to major arteries like Florida's Turnpike and Interstate 95, offering straightforward travel to and from the airport and other parts of South Florida. Parking is generally ample directly at the academy facilities, though arrive early during peak tournament weekends to secure preferred spots and avoid potential traffic congestion on Summit Boulevard and surrounding roads as visitors converge. The nearest major airport is Palm Beach International Airport (PBI), located approximately a 15-20 minute drive northeast, with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ood International Airport (FLL) being a longer but viable alternative for those seeking more flight options. Rideshare services are readily available, and while public transit options exist, they may not be the most convenient for direct access to the sports complex, especially during event hours. Planning your arrival about 30-45 minutes before scheduled games or activities is advisable to allow for parking, check-in, and settling in without rushing.

Things to Do

Walkable

Okeeheelee Park

0.5 mi

This expansive county park is adjacent to the Junior Academy and offers a fantastic escape for players and families. It features a variety of amenities, including walking and biking trails, a large lake for paddleboarding and kayaking (rentals often available), playgrounds for younger siblings, and ample open green space perfect for a post-game picnic or casual kick-around. The park also includes a public golf course and a nature center, providing diverse options for recreation and relaxation right on the doorstep of your sports activities. It’s an ideal spot for downtime between games or for a relaxed morning before the day's events begin.

Palm Beach Zoo & Conservation Society

3.0 mi

Located within Okeeheelee Park but a short drive from the academy, the Palm Beach Zoo offers a delightful outing for all ages. It houses a diverse collection of animals in naturalistic habitats, focusing on conservation efforts. Visitors can enjoy exploring exhibits featuring big cats, primates, and a variety of native Florida wildlife. The zoo also features a splash pad area for children, making it a perfect destination for families looking to cool off and learn about wildlife after a morning of sports.

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ter offers mild and dry conditions, with average daytime temperatures in the low 70s Fahrenheit. It's comfortable for outdoor play, though evenings can be cooler, requiring a light jacket or long sleeves. Pack layers to adjust to temperature fluctuations, and sun protection remains important.

🌱

Spring & early summer

As spring progresses into early summer, temperatures begin to climb, often reaching the high 80s and low 90s Fahrenheit. Humidity increases, and the chance of brief, intense afternoon thunderstorms rises. Lightweight, breathable clothing is essential, and staying hydrated is critical during outdoor activities.

☀️

Mid-summer

Mid-summer is characterized by high heat and humidity, with daytime temperatures consistently in the low 90s Fahrenheit and heat index values often feeling much higher. Afternoon showers are very common, so be prepared for sudden downpours and quick cooling. Prioritize shade, hydration, and indoor breaks during the hottest parts of the day.

🍂

Fall season

Fall brings a gradual cooling and reduction in humidity, making it one of the most pleasant times for outdoor events. Daytime temperatures typically range from the mid-70s to low 80s Fahrenheit. While still warm, it's far more comfortable than summer, with fewer rain disruptions and enjoyable outdoor conditions.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ain is most frequent during the summer months in the form of afternoon thunderstorms, which can cause temporary delays but usually pass quickly. Snow is extremely rare to non-existent in this region. Always monitor weather forecasts for potential rain delays and ensure you have rain gear or indoor alternatives available.
